Its Friday and time for a quick round up of mixes that’ll get me through the weekend with a smile on my face. First up is the excellent Lotion and Motion mix from up and coming DJ/Producer and OMG resident Tekton Naggar.

Tekton has been tearing up dancefloors across Bristol and the South West with his unique blend of Global Bass; mashing together Dubstep, Kuduro, Baile Funk, and Booty Bass in a way that is guaranteed to make the party go off!

Just came across this cheeky pair of Bootlegs on the excellent Music Forest blog (excellent if you read Japanese, pretty good even if you can't). Mr Milanese has had his fingers on the remix buttons and done a couple of cheeky bootlegs of tunes from his 2006 debut album Extend.

Caramel fixup takes his sublime Caramel Cognac and blends it with Dizzee Rascal's dancefloor smash Fix Up Look Sharp turning into a brooding bass heavy monster:

Just got the promo through for the new David Last / MC Zulu album Musically Massive and it really does live up to its name. Last has put together an album of tight minimal dancehall, house, soca and carnival riddims. The mighty Zulu's vocal work references everything from cult film The Warriors, Spanish fly, and doo wop.


Ghettoblaster is a cheeky electro dancehall banger that sounds like it could've come out of the Toddla T mix of the same name:
